What is Manna?

We're glad you asked. Manna is an ongoing dinner and discussion experiment put together by College of Charleston students to bring together students of different beliefs and backgrounds for meaningful conversation and relationships.

Whether you're over the bar scene, hung over from Friday night, or just seeking some thoughtful people to chat up, Manna seeks to be the alternative night out with just a touch of class.
